Is Finku Safe? Examining Security and Reliability

One of the most important questions for any investor is, is Finku safe? Security is paramount when it comes to your money, so let's break down the security measures and reliability factors of Finku. Most reputable platforms, including Finku, use a range of security protocols to protect your investments and personal information. This usually includes encryption to secure your data, two-factor authentication (2FA) for added account security, and regular security audits to identify and address vulnerabilities. The platform must also comply with industry regulations to ensure the safety of your investments. Check if the platform is regulated by reputable financial authorities. The regulations help protect investors and ensure the platform operates within legal and ethical guidelines. Also, make sure that the platform offers insurance coverage. The platform should have insurance to protect your investments in case of fraud or other unforeseen circumstances. The platform should also provide clear and transparent information about its security measures. Look for detailed descriptions of the security measures they have in place, such as encryption protocols, two-factor authentication, and security audits. Reputable platforms are transparent about their security practices. They are transparent about their fees, investment options, and other essential information. This transparency builds trust and helps you make informed decisions. Also, consider the platform's history and reputation. Check online reviews, testimonials, and ratings from other users to get insights into their experiences. This helps you assess the platform's reliability and customer satisfaction. It's also important to practice safe investing habits yourself. Protect your login credentials, be wary of phishing attempts, and regularly monitor your account activity. These practices enhance your security and protect your investments. It's also important to research the platform's financial stability. Check whether the platform is financially stable and has the resources to meet its obligations. Make sure that they are transparent about their financial operations.

Moreover, remember to review the platform's terms of service and privacy policy. Understand the platform's security practices, data handling policies, and dispute resolution procedures. Before investing, ensure that you fully understand the risks involved. Investing in the stock market can be risky, and you could lose money. Always conduct thorough research and understand the risks before making any investment decisions. Optimizing Your Investment Strategy with Finku

Let's get strategic! Here's how to maximize your finku returns and build a solid investment strategy. First, define your investment goals. What do you hope to achieve with your investments? Are you saving for retirement, a down payment on a house, or simply building wealth? Understanding your goals is the foundation of your investment strategy. Assess your risk tolerance. How much risk are you comfortable taking? Your risk tolerance will influence the types of investments you choose. If you're risk-averse, you'll want to invest in lower-risk options. Create a diversified portfolio. Don't put all your eggs in one basket. Diversify your investments across different asset classes, such as stocks, bonds, and ETFs, to reduce risk and increase the potential for higher returns. Take advantage of automated investing. Finku usually allows you to set up recurring investments to contribute to your portfolio regularly. This helps you stay consistent with your investment strategy. Review your portfolio regularly. It is essential to monitor your portfolio's performance and make adjustments as needed. Rebalance your portfolio periodically to maintain your desired asset allocation. Stay informed and educated. Keep up to date with market trends, investment strategies, and financial news. Take advantage of Finku's educational resources and consider consulting with a financial advisor if needed. Take advantage of tax-advantaged accounts. If available, consider investing in tax-advantaged accounts, such as retirement accounts, to reduce your tax liabilities.

Another point to remember is to stay patient. Investing takes time, and you shouldn't expect to get rich quickly. Focus on the long term and avoid making impulsive decisions based on short-term market fluctuations. Review and adjust your investment strategy regularly to ensure it aligns with your goals and risk tolerance. It's a good idea to seek professional financial advice. If you're unsure about your investment strategy, seek the guidance of a qualified financial advisor. They can help you create a personalized plan tailored to your needs.
